Time's Divide (The Chronos Files), by Rysa Walker

The Cyrists are swiftly moving into position to begin the Culling, and Kate’s options are dwindling. With each jump to the past or the future, Kate may trigger a new timeline shift. Worse, the loyalties of those around her—including the allegiances of Kiernan and the Fifth Column, the shadowy group working with Kate—are increasingly unclear.

Kate will risk everything, including her life, to prevent the future her grandfather and the Cyrists have planned. But, when time runs out, it may take an even bigger sacrifice to protect the people she loves.

About the Author

Rysa Walker is the author of the runaway hit Timebound, which was the 2013 Amazon Breakthrough Novel Award Grand Prize winner, its sequel Time’s Edge, and the novella Time’s Echo. Walker grew up on a cattle ranch in the South, where her entertainment options included talking to cows and reading books. On the rare occasion that she gained control of the television, she watched Star Trek and imagined living in the future, on distant planets, or at least in a town big enough to have a stoplight. She now lives in North Carolina with her husband, two sons, and their golden retriever, Lucy.

Kate & her allies race against time to thwart Saul’s plan to kill billions in this fantastic finale to the trilogy!
By Chris F.
After the conclusion of “Time’s Edge”, Kate now has allies in her plan to stop Saul’s nefarious plot to cull the majority of humanity, leaving only those whom he deems truly faithful to his Cyrist religion alive. Led by Julia Waters, this small compartmentalized crew is only one part of the larger resistance called The Fifth Column. These allies are in a prime position to help Kate in her fight against Saul, as they are a faction hidden inside the Cyrist hierarchy. But are their goals completely aligned with Kate’s or do they have some hidden agendas that could derail her plans? In the meantime, Kate knows The Culling is coming very soon and once they learn the date it will occur, the countdown is on! The odds are against them and the situation is grim as they all try to stop Saul from implementing his terrorist plan.

Also, stalwart ally Kiernan is acting very strangely lately, more withdrawn and less like himself than usual. Continuing to act as a double agent within the Cyrist ranks, what secrets might he be withholding from Kate? Could they mean he is ultimately untrustworthy and unreliable when Kate needs him most, in this final battle against Saul?

The story barely takes time to breathe as it moves at a breakneck pace from beginning to end as we time travel from one era to another. In between the action, as there is plenty, we get many wonderful character scenes, from Kate to Kiernan, to Kate’s boyfriend Trey and Kate’s best friend Charlayne and everyone in-between. By now, having spent much time with them in all of their books and short stories, we know them backward and forwards like old friends, right down to their quirks. Who they are, what they believe and how they respond to each obstacle they struggle to overcome are all consistent with their beliefs and are quite enjoyable to spend time with. (Except for the bad guys, who are NOT enjoyable to spend time with but are definitely well-rounded characters).

From Kate making a trip to London to ferret out whether Houdini was using a Chronos medallion in his magic act to meeting Victoria Woodhull, a leader in the woman’s suffrage movement in the late-1870’s, the historical research was spot on, integrated well into the story and only enhanced the narrative. Along these wild time travel journeys, Kate forms some unusual alliances, there are some really unexpected, jaw-dropping plot twists that I never saw coming and some beautiful character moments that were truly wonderful to read. And for the first time, Kate even visits the future in the year 2308 to retrieve something vitally important to their plan to stop The Culling. All of these character and story threads are woven effortlessly into the story, coalescing into a heart-stopping and heart-breaking finale. Everyone gets time to shine and all plot threads are tied up. But since the stakes are so high, we truly wonder: will everyone survive to the finale and live happily ever after? Especially Kate, who might be called upon to make the biggest sacrifice of all?

With a high-octane book like this one where the time travel is fast and furious, you might wonder whether it goes off the rails, as time travel can be a tricky subject to write about without contradicting things. Wonder no more, as the author impressively handles this complicated aspect of the story very smoothly, making it easy to understand and a joy to read with each time jump the characters take. I also really enjoyed the science fiction/pop culture references. There are many references that subtly reference Harry Potter, the “V” television miniseries, Star Wars and Star Trek in the story so fluently without drawing attention to itself and yet, serve the narrative whether you know the reference or not. In particular, the Harry Potter reference that Trey makes in chapter four was both funny and clever.

Finally, I would be remiss if I didn’t mention how well the story picks up from threads from her novella “Time’s Mirror”. It’s an entertaining story in its own right that stands on its own. You could read “Time’s Divide” without having read the novella before doing so, but it is a much deeper, more enhanced experience if you read the novella first.

“Time’s Divide” is an outstanding conclusion to the Chronos Files trilogy that tells its story on a wide and sophisticated canvas spanning many eras. It wraps you in its grip and moves at such a demanding pace, it doesn’t let you pause until the end, making the book extremely hard to put down until you reach the highly satisfying conclusion. =)
